A frame set designed for maximum rigidity, speed, and uncompromising road suitability. The seamless integration of all cables into the frame, cockpit, and fork perfectly emphasizes the minimalist design. Mechanically, the Shimano Ultegra group provides optimal performance, functionality, and weight, typical of racing machines. For enhanced comfort on bumpy pothole-ridden streets, we typically use X-Road tires with a diameter of 30 mm; however, the frame can also accommodate gravel widths of up to 40 mm. The tubeless carbon wheelset DT Swiss ER 1600 Spline DB32 offers multiple tire width options and can be tailored for gravel roads thanks to its maximum tire clearance. Comfort features include the hidden, shock-absorbing D-profile seat post with a lock integrated into the top tube and the flat Aero aluminum handlebar. Clever details that enhance both the bike and the ride include tools and items such as the removable magnetic lever for loosening and securing the thru-axles, concealed mounting points for lightweight fenders, and the state-of-the-art racing saddle Fizik Antares.
